Title: | Design of self-powered energy-harvesting imager | Authors: | Lim, Alfred Wee Chung. | Keywords: | DRNTU::Engineering::Electrical and electronic engineering::Electronic circuits | Issue Date: | 2012 | Abstract: | This Final Year Project report covers the theoretical background, explanation of various functional blocks, and performance analysis of each functional block which targets to achieve low-power, high-sensitivity and self-powered application. One technique was proposed to increase the efficiency of power management unit. | URI: | http://hdl.handle.net/10356/50272 | Schools: | School of Electrical and Electronic Engineering | Rights: | Nanyang Technological University | Fulltext Permission: | restricted | Fulltext Availability: | With Fulltext |
